Introduction to Urban Regeneration: Understanding the concept, principles, and importance of urban regeneration. • Urban Analysis and Assessment: Techniques for evaluating urban areas, including spatial analysis, demographic assessment, and economic appraisal. • Urban Planning and Design: The role of planning and design in urban regeneration, including master planning, urban design principles, and sustainable design. • Stakeholder Engagement: Strategies for engaging with stakeholders, including community participation, public-private partnerships, and conflict resolution. • Sustainable Urban Regeneration: The principles of sustainable urban regeneration, including green infrastructure, sustainable transport, and low carbon development. • Urban Regeneration Financing: Sources of funding for urban regeneration, including public and private investment, grants, and loans. • Implementation and Monitoring: The implementation and monitoring of urban regeneration projects, including project management, impact assessment, and evaluation. • Case Studies in Urban Regeneration: Analysis of successful and unsuccessful urban regeneration projects, including best practices and lessons learned.
